I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Requêtes et SQL. Discussion :

Utilisation formulaire dans requete


Sujet :

Requêtes et SQL.

  1. #1
    Débutant
    Profil pro
    Inscrit en
    Mai 2003
    Messages
    41
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2003
    Messages : 41
    Points : 38
    Points
    38
    Par défaut Utilisation formulaire dans requete
    Bonjour,

    L'une de mes requetes utilise les valeurs des différents champs d'un formulaire. Le formulaire à pour nom "prévisions d'activité" , les champs utiliosés sont "RefR",RefV", "datedeb" et "datefin".

    Voici le code de la requete :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    SELECT Table_détail_heures_prévisionnelles.Prévision * [Table Tarif].[Prix du tarif] + [Montant Forfait] AS totalligne, *
    FROM [Table Heures prévisionnelles], Table_détail_heures_prévisionnelles, [Table Tarif], [Table Prévisionnelle], [Table Responsable], [Table Vacataire]
    WHERE [Table Heures prévisionnelles].[Ref Prévisionnel] = [Table Prévisionnelle].[Ref Prévisionnel]
    AND [Table Prévisionnelle].[Ref Vacataire] = [Table Vacataire].[Ref Vacataire]
    AND [Table Prévisionnelle].[Ref Responsable] = [Table Responsable].[Ref Responsable]
    AND [Table Heures prévisionnelles].[Ref heures prévisionnelles] = Table_détail_heures_prévisionnelles.[Ref heures prévisionnelles]
    AND Table_détail_heures_prévisionnelles.[Ref Tarif] = [Table Tarif].[Ref Tarif]
    AND [Table Responsable].[Ref Responsable] = Forms![prévisions d'activité]![RefR]
    AND [Table Vacataire].[Ref Vacataire] = Forms![prévisions d'activité]![RefV]
    AND [Table Heures prévisionnelles].[Date commencement] >= Forms![prévisions d'activité]![datedeb]
    AND [Table Heures prévisionnelles].[Date fin] <= Forms![prévisions d'activité]![datefin];
    La requete fonctionne et utilise bien le formulaire voulu. Lorsqu'on execute la requete, le formulaire "Prévisions d'activité" est lancée. Lorsque l'utilisateur clique sur un bouton du formulaire alors celui ci disparait et la requete est executer avec les bons parametres.

    Jusque la pas de probleme mais j'ai développez cette requete sous une des derniere versions d'access et la personne qui doit l'utiliser n'a que Access 2000 ( 9.0.6926 SP-3). Sous cette version la requete n'est pas corectement executer, il s'emble que cette version ne comprenne pas les expression du type form![prévisions d'activité]! ....


    Comment faire ?

    PS : La requete est ensuite utilisée par un état.

  2. #2
    Débutant
    Profil pro
    Inscrit en
    Mai 2003
    Messages
    41
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2003
    Messages : 41
    Points : 38
    Points
    38
    Par défaut
    s'viou plait ..... quelqu'un doit bien connaitre une solution.
    Il faut aboslument que je rende ce projet.

  3. #3
    Débutant
    Profil pro
    Inscrit en
    Mai 2003
    Messages
    41
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2003
    Messages : 41
    Points : 38
    Points
    38
    Par défaut
    Est-ce que quelqu'un peut au moins me dire si oui ou nom Access 2000 acepte les requete SQL contenant des expression du type = Form!Nomformulaire!NomChamp.
    Que je sache au moins si le probleme vient de la ?

  4. #4
    Faw
    Faw est déconnecté
    Membre expérimenté

    Profil pro
    Inscrit en
    Juin 2004
    Messages
    1 169
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2004
    Messages : 1 169
    Points : 1 383
    Points
    1 383
    Par défaut
    Et la faq billy?
    http://access.developpez.com/faq/?pa...riteres#txtQry
    regarde aussi le sujet suivant signé Fred.G.

Discussions similaires

  1. Réponses: 4
    Dernier message: 14/04/2014, 20h29
  2. [AC-2007] Utiliser un champ calculé d'un formulaire dans une requete
    Par eliottgiraudo dans le forum Requêtes et SQL.
    Réponses: 22
    Dernier message: 14/08/2013, 17h54
  3. [Requete] Utiliser un controle de sous formulaire dans SQL
    Par gwendk dans le forum Requêtes et SQL.
    Réponses: 9
    Dernier message: 09/05/2006, 17h53
  4. Requete SQL : Utiliser 'AND' dans un DECODE
    Par LoulouFifi dans le forum Oracle
    Réponses: 2
    Dernier message: 02/12/2005, 10h26
  5. Utilisation d'une requete dans une requete update
    Par hellbilly dans le forum Access
    Réponses: 4
    Dernier message: 09/01/2005, 16h09

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o